The car's genuine, and it's a tuned M3 as well, but it's not an M3 GTR. Sumo power couldn't get one of thoes to tune. Sumo power created the car in conjunction with EA to promote NFS:MW and then they gave the car away on the games launch on MTV. I think the ad could be genuine since anyone could own the car.
